So I will try to make this short and sweet but there are alot of details you may need in order to give proper advice:
I got a new 29g tank on Nov 17th and i filled it and left it for about 24 hrs before putting about 7-8 fish. One otto, 2 dwarf gouramis, 3 fancy guppies, 2 mollies.
Within the first week or so I had alot of deaths. Fish were bought at Walmart and they kept replacing them.
Finally discovered that I made a big mistake and tried to correct it by doing weekly gravel vacuums and 35-45% water changes, started adding aquaplus every time i completed the water change.
I took my water to the pet store on weekly basis to get tested. Got my ammonia under control...now reads 0.0. Last couple of times though my nitrites and nitrates are high. Very pink when tested. For about 3 weeks I thought I had it under control and had no deaths.
Recently my otto died, I noticed one of the nostril looking things on his snout was bleeding and looked like something gouged him...notice he was EXTREMELY skinny (he had been fine till this time). I automatically thought he was hungry so I took him out of the tank and put him in a smaller .5 g tank I had and took the tank water to fill it. Gave him some food..live bearer food is what I use for all of my fish..but overnite he passed
All my other fish seem to be doing great...its now Jan 2, so over a month and a half since I first started with the tank.
I now have the 2 dwarf gouramis, 3 fancy guppies, 3 coral platys, 1 marble molly, 3 black mollies, and 1 baby black molly and 2 baby platys (in the bredding tank in the top corner). All fish have been in the tank for at least a month and doing fine..babys have been there for about 2 wks now. I did have one outbreak (i think of ich) and did a treatment but all is good since then. My gouramis little whisker thingys are starting to grow back.
Any suggestions would be appreciated on what to do to a) get my water perfected and b) what kind of bottom feeder should I get next.
Pet store had told me otto wouldn't need food...but after reading all the forums I believe they were wrong.
Like I said i'm new to this whole fish scenario and I want them all to be happy and healthy so advice is greatly appreciated.
Oh and water temp is 81 degrees as I heard this wards of ich and other diseases...
